Default Re: Simultaneous Movement (PBW) Stellar Manipulation?

Strategic benefit? Placing it as far from warppoints as possible will help slow down enemy sun-busters. (A system near the edge of the map may have all WPs on one side)
Alternatively, you could place the star on a warppoint, eventually generating a ringworld to use as warppoint defense

Probably easier to just move the warppoints around the star instead.

You may also want to place the star on an asteroid field, so that you get a sphereworld with a planet and/or moons.
That type of situation is good for training facilities.
It would also allow your planet to defend against sunbusters with the full benefits of spaceyard and huge cargo space for fighters and such.
